Looking at getting one of 4 guns this weekend and was looking for a little help on chooseing. The first 3 are pistols and gonna be used for C&C and Carry for backup in the woods. S&W 2" .357, Tarus 454 Casull, Springfield GI 5" 1911. Also looking at ordering the FNH US PS90 (P90 sub-machinegun Civi version) Chambered in 9mm. If you like a diff make/model of the same gun please post them cause i am pretty open at the momment

I always likes the 1911 .45's. They have plenty of power and if you have to shoot somebody you don't have to worry about them getting up. I've seen a guy get shot 3 times in the gut with a .38 from around 25 yards away and get up and run away. The next day the guy that shot him went and bought a .41 magnum. If you ever have to protect yourself you don't have time to aim carefully and you want as large a bullet as you can shoot comfortably in case you don't make a perfect hit.

If you accually look at the 500 or 460 S&W you might be turned off. They are HUGE. You might as well carry a rifle. Or a Thompson Center pistol chambered for Rifle cartriges. I dont see the point of packing a pistol thats damn near the size of a rifle. It defeats the whole point of a pistol.
